It is the grievance of the petitioner that his representation dated 11.04.2017 seeking to to grant drought sheme amount, has not been considered by the respondents till date and therefore, he has filed the present writ petition.

4. This Court has not expressed any of its view with regard to the merits of the representation made by the petitioner. It is needless to point out that whenever a representation of this nature is made, the respondents are duty bound to consider the same in one way or the other. Non-consideration of the same would https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

amount to dereliction of ordinary duties of their office and as such, this Court would be justified in invoking its powers conferred under Article 226 of the Constitution of India to direct them to consider the petitioner's representation within a stipulated time.

5. In view of the limited prayer sought for in this writ petition, there shall be a direction to the second respondent to consider the petitioner's representation dated 11.04.2017 on its own merits and take further action in accordance with law, within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. Such an exercise shall be done after giving due opportunity to the petitioner and any other persons who may be interested in the subject matter.

6. With the above directions, this writ petition is disposed of. No costs.
